Abstract :

 Arthrogryposis multiplex congenita is a term describing the presence of various arthrogenic contractures at the moment of birth, limiting, to a certain degree, the range of joints mobility. The incidence of the disease is low––1 per 3,000 births and it is usually not determined genetically. Here we are discussing a newborn baby presented in NICU of Govt. Medical College with multiple joint contractures.
